Transaction 61e654046029b09064fdac39823bd96ab84fe88ac4c0977883fab532171ab66c
1 Input
1 Output
-
61e654046029b09064fdac39823bd96ab84fe88ac4c0977883fab532171ab66c:0
- value
- 4340869
- script pubkey
- OP_0 OP_PUSHBYTES_20 fbda97fcf6ec823a6dd72a81119cbf41c32ed028
- address
- bc1ql0df0l8kajpr5mwh92q3r89lg8pja5pg2ck9r8